The first installment of $5,056 is paid after a workplan is completed. The remainder is received when the work products are completed and accepted by DCA. The contract itself must be signed by the Mayor. Also, a representative from the City of Dania must be named to be responsible for administration of this contract. lt is suggested that I be that person or the City Manager be named. A significant amount of effort will be necessary to update Danias' plan. lt is a requirement to update information on local conditions so the areas annexed since 1990 will need to be added. This includes updating all data bases, such as population projections and all maps within the Comprehensive Plan. The update also requires updated traffic counts, a review of each element of the plan, and the effects of concurrency. This will require assistance from contractors such as Berry and Calvin or others. lt is suggested that the budget reflect a revenue source in the amount of $20,224, but also an expenditure in the like amount under contractual services in the Growth Management Department budget. WA;lc CITY OF DANIA INTEROFFICE MEMORANDUM GROWTH MANAGEMENT DEPARTMENT TO: CONTRACT WTH THE STATE OF FLORIDA DEPARTMENT OF COMMUNITY AFFAIRS FOR EVALUATING THE COMPREHENSIVE PLAN Dania, like each local government in Florida, is required to prepare and submit an evaluation and appraisal report (EAR) on its comprehensive plan. Such a report, to monitor and update the plan, is required each five years. The 1994 State Legislature appropriated funds to assist local governments prepare the initial draft of the EAR. The amount of funds available to each of 89 communities, including Dania, is $20,224. ln order to receive the funds a contract must be signed and returned to DCA by August 15,1994. Sincerely, (.,,r^^r/*/- RoseAnn Webb JLlr-?2-1994 ).6:79 OT1N I FAX P.A2 DANIA AIRPORT ADVISORY COMMINEE IOO WEST DANIA BEACH EOULEVARD DANIA, FL 33004 June 20, 1994 RUTH HANKERSON 746 S.W. 3RD COUrr DANIA, FL 33004 Under Article II, Section 7 of the byJaws of the Dania Airport Advisory Committee concerning absences to wit: IF A COMMITTEE MEMBER HAS THREE (3) CONSECUTIVE UNEXCUSED ABSENCES lN A TWELVE (12) MONTH SPAN, SAID MEMBER SHALL HAVE AUTOMATICALLY RESIGNED THEIR POSITION AND THE CHAIRPERSON SHALL NOTIFY THE DANIA CITY COMMISSION TO APPOINT A NEW MEMBER. A COMMITTEE MEMBER CAN APPLY FOR AN EXCUSE BY WRITING THE CLERK OF THE CITY OF DANIA BEFORE THE DATE AND TIME OF THE MEETING STATING THE REASONS FOR THEIR ABSENCE. THE COMMITTEE SHALL VOTE ON WHETHER NOT TO GRANT THE EXCUSE. IF A MA.IORITY OF THOSE ATTENDING THE MEETING VOTE YES, THE EXCUSE WLL BE GRANTED TO THE ABSENT MEMBER. THE CHAIRPERSON SHALL NOTIFY A MEMBER BY MAILWHO ACCUMUI-ATES TWO (2) CONSECUTIVE UNEXCUSED ABSENCES rN A TWELVE (12) MONTH SPAN WTH COPIES OF SAID NOTICE DEPOSITED WTH THE CLERK OF THE CITY OF DANIA AND THE DANIA CITY MANAGER.
